BBC Studios Announces New ‘Bluey’ ProductsBBC Studios Announces New ‘Bluey’ Products
Newly-announced products include Arnott’s Bluey Muesli Bars and the “Hammerbarn” playset from Moose Toys.
March 7, 2023
BBC Studios Kids & Family, co-commissioner and global distributor for “Bluey,” has announced an expanded portfolio.
Arnott’s is venturing into the muesli bar aisle with two “Bluey” Muesli Bars flavors: Yoghurt & Fancy Fruit, and Sherbet. The muesli bars will be the third product in Arnott’s “Bluey” range, with its Biscuit multi-packs launching in June last year, before expanding into share packs in January.
Moose Toys has also unveiled its supersized “Hammerbarn” playsets; Hunter Leisure (arts and crafts and outdoor products); Benson’s (cards and stationery); MJM (puzzles and games); VTech (interactive games); TOMY (bath toys); Headstart (ride-on toys); and newly signed partner, Jasnor (wooden toys and outdoor play).
“We’ll be celebrating five years of the show later this year, and there’s no doubt that ‘Bluey’ – just like a plucky little preschooler – is a phenomenon that Australians can be immensely proud of,” says Kate O’Connor, head, licensing and brands, Australia, BBC Studios. “With so many achievements already in the bag, 2023 is set to be another year of success and celebration.”
“Bluey” was also named won “Preschool License of the Year” for the fourth consecutive year at the Australian Toy Association Awards.
